Firefox starts but won't load anything

User-Agent: Mozilla/4.0 (compatible; MSIE 6.0; Windows NT 5.1; SV1) Build Identifier: When I start Firefox it will open a window and it will sit there and not load anything. At the bottom lefthand corner where it tells you the website title of what it is trying to load all that will ever read is start.mozilla.org..... and thats all Firefox will do. It just won't concet. Reproducible: Always Steps to Reproduce: 1.Click on any icon to start Firefox. 2.Window opens and does nothing. 3. Actual Results: The window will sit there and try to load. Over a day of wait there was still nothing up in the window Expected Results: the google page should have loaded No website when typed in will load.

If you're using a firewall, make sure that it doesn't block Firefox. It's the most common problem, especially after an update.
